Docetaxel-induced neuropathy: a pharmacogenetic case-control study of 150 women with early-stage breast cancer.
Acta oncologica (Stockholm, Sweden) - 1 Apr 2015
Eckhoff Lise, Feddersen Søren, Knoop Ann S, Ewertz Marianne, Bergmann Troels K
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ND: Docetaxel is a highly effective treatment of a wide range of malignancies but is often associated with peripheral neuropathy. The genetic variability of genes involved in the transportation or metabolism of docetaxel may be responsible for the variation in docetaxel-induced peripheral neuropathy (DIPN). The main purpose of this study was to investigate the impact of genetic variants in GSTP1 and ABCB1...
